Glam and Glitz for Christmas Dining

I like to keep the dining room table set, as it is the first room you see when you enter our home. We are also on our neighborhood House Tour this coming Friday night. So, I wanted to share this with you. This is a long post as I decided to share the whole room, so get comfy if you want to follow along:) As you know, I always love a touch of leopard. So, I added the napkins and the votives.
 The gold embroidered napkins were my MIL's and are hand made and beautiful!
 Beaded placemats and my good black and gold china are perfect for this special holiday!
 The little beaded trees are ornaments.
 A forest of trees march along the center of the table
 and my Grandmothers wine glasses grace each place setting.



 The view from the foyer
 Trees are on the pillows too.



 Lots of candles are on the table too. They are all LED so can be left unattended.
 I found these pretty gold tapers this year.

 And I made the centerpiece several years ago.

 The runner says NOEL at each end in beaded letters.

 In the corner I placed this small tree and decorated it with gold ornaments and a touch of leopard on it too.








In this corner several belsnickle Santas sit on the tiny server.



 This antique one is a favorite.





 As the sun goes down the room glows.



 Leopard packages and clip on ornaments are on the garland along with gold garland and red berries.

2 of my 4 Bathrooms at Christmas

Yes, I have 4 bathrooms and do decorate all of them but will share the other 2 later. These 2 are the public ones that people see when they come here or we are entertaining. I am starting with this bathroom on the main floor. I got the leopard towels at Walmart when we first moved in here so I tried to decorate with those colors. Notice the soap dispenser; a snowlady with a leopard jacket:). And the paper towels are a leopard with a Christmas wreath around his neck.

 I found these Christmas towels at Boscovs one day a few years ago and grabbed every one they had!!! I couldn't believe that they were Christmas trees in a leopard print!!!!

 The leopard clip on ornaments came from Walmart last year.



 I always decorate the soap dish too.

 This guy is one of my FAVORITE Santas.
 His coat is just beautiful!!!
 Now we will go downstairs. This powder room is what guests use when we are entertaining down here.
 These towels were found years ago at Big Lots, they were $5.00 for each set!
 These ornaments match perfectly, again from Walmart!


 I found these pretty towels at TJMaxx after Christmas last year.
 This wax warmer is also from Walmart.



 The lit package came from Kirklands, several years ago.


So that is 2 of my bath rooms. I'll share the others when I can but this post would be way too long:)
